Since 2003 Zenyogkido has been actively working with charities such as Just A Drop (who provide clean water in deprived areas all across the world) The Derbyshire Leicestershire and Rutland Air Ambulance and Pablos, a Horse sanctuary based near Melton Mowbray. 

 

The money is collected through various activities such as THE KROX BASH, an all day bag hitting session, where teams of three train like maniacs, or by direct donations collected from our Tai Chi and meditation groups. The lessons are free but we ask, if people can afford it, to make a small donation each class.

 

Some of our members have undertaken endurance events such as a 24 hour Fan dance climb. The `Fan Dance` is a part of special forces selection training. During selection the candidates have to cover the 15 mile mountain course with 45 lbs back packs in under 4 hours. The 24 hour event our members took part in was to do the fan dance route as many times as they could in 24 hours. Some of the guys did it 3 times!

 

Another method of collecting money some of the ladies from our Tai chi and meditation groups use, is to run holistic therapy days from their own homes, They offer various holistic therapies at reduced rates, and sell lots of wonderful cakes and drinks as well as books.

One member quite simply takes out a collection tub once a year around his business centre and his residents kindly make donations.

Zenyogkido members have also ran car boot events, long distance bike rides, half marathons and many other functions to raise cash. To date we have raised over £40,000  for the above mentioned charities.
